Table des matières

Introduction and Characteristics
Part I. Asymmetric Synthesis
Metal-catalyzed Asymmetric Synthesis of Biaryl Atropisomers
Organocatalytic Asymmetric Synthesis of Biaryl Atropisomers
Enantioselective Synthesis of Heterobiaryl Atropisomers
Asymmetric Synthesis of Non-Biaryls Atropisomers
Asymmetric Synthesis of Chiral Allenes
Asymmetric Synthesis of Axially Chiral Natural Products

Part II. Applications
Asymmetric Transformations
Application for Axially Chiral Ligands
Application for Axially Chiral Organocatalysts
Application in Drugs and Materials

A propos de l’auteur

Bin Tan, tenured full professor, is the vice-chair of chemistry department at Southern University of Science and Technology (SUSTech) in Shenzhen, China. He obtained his M.S. from Xiamen University in 2005, and his Ph.D. from Nanyang Technological University in 2010 with Prof. Guofu Zhong. After two and a half year postdoctoral studies at The Scripps Research Institute with Prof. Carlos F. Barbas, he started his independent career as an associate professor at SUSTech at the end of 2012. His research focuses on asymmetric construction of axially chiral compounds, core structure directed organocatalytic asymmetric synthesis and asymmetric multiple component reactions.
